TASK: THE NEWS REPORT
Use the checklist below to guide students as they complete their news report. These are the
required components of this task.
CHECKLIST
 Newspaper headline included.
 Clear connection between photo, headline and content.
 List of labeled 5 Ws and How in the Rough Notes section.
 The first word of the first paragraph should be: Yesterday,
 Transitions are included to connect sentences: then, also, furthermore, finally.
 The words I, me, we, us, our, you, yours can only be used in quotations from people in
the picture or witnesses. Two to three eye witness accounts included.
 Use as many specific details as possible. Use first and last names, specific places, etc.
 Try to use at least three quotations in your news report.
 Quotation marks around interview responses from witnesses or people involved.
 Verbs are in past tense (usually “—ed”). Do not use the continuous tense (“—ing”).
Example: The students worked on a project.
NOT
The students were working on a project.
 Proofread for spelling, grammar, and punctuation.

TASK: SHORT WRITING PIECE
Use the checklist below to guide students as they complete their short writing piece. These
are the required components of this task.
CHECKLIST
Student…
 Uses rough notes to organize ideas to support his or her response.
 Turns the question prompt into a statement.
EXAMPLE: State your favourite holiday. Explain why you like it.
Will become…
My favourite holiday is Christmas (Easter, Thanksgiving- pick ONE) because…
(Write two points in particular).
***This will be your topic sentence***
 States each point and provides proof (an example) in two separate sentences.
 Uses transitions to connect sentences: then, also, furthermore, finally.
 Ends response with a concluding sentence summarizing the main idea.
 Proof-reads for the following:
o
o
o
o
o
full sentences
proper capitalization
proper punctuation
proper spelling
proper grammar
EXAMPLE:
Point 1
Proof 1
Topic Sentence
My favourite holiday is Christmas because I get to give presents and get to spend time with
my family. Every Christmas I spend a lot of time choosing the perfect gifts for my family and
friends. For example, this year I made my best friend a knitted scarf in her favourite colour.
Also, Christmas is my favourite holiday because I get to see family members that I don’t
normally get to see. For example, my grandmother from Russia spent a whole month with
us last December. This is why Christmas is my favourite holiday.

TASK: SERIES OF PARAGRAPHS
Use the checklist below to guide students as they complete their series of paragraphs. These
are the required components of this task.
CHECKLIST
Student…
 Uses rough notes to organize ideas to support his or her response.
 Has four paragraphs: an introductory paragraph, two body paragraphs and a concluding
paragraph.
 Either agrees OR disagrees (NOT BOTH) with the prompt.
 Uses at least two point-proof-comments in his/her body paragraphs (see chart below)
and maintains a clear, consistent opinion.
 Organizes ideas logically.
 Proof-reads for the following:
o
o
o
o
o
full sentences
proper capitalization
proper punctuation
proper spelling
proper grammar
 Concludes paragraph by:
o Re-stating opinion
o Summarizing main points
o Including a final thought- connection to world/community?

TASK – M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TIONS
Use the checklist below to guide students as they complete their multiple choice questions.
These are the required components of this task.
CHECKLIST
Student…
 Reads the questions carefully before looking at all possible answers.
 Comes up with the answer in his/her head before looking at the possible answers. This
way the choices given on the test won't throw the student off or trick them.
 Eliminates answers that are obviously incorrect.
 Reads all the choices before choosing his/her answer.
 Always take an educated guess and select an answer.
TASK: GRAPHIC SELECTONS
Use the checklist below to guide students as they complete their graphic reading selection.
These are the required components of this task.
CHECKLIST
Students…
 Look at the title first- it is the largest font- identifies the topic and document type (i.e.
Map, glossary, index, schedule)
 Read any small text – near the title- this will give an overview of the graphic selection
 Scan the sheet- make sure you scan the whole sheet
 Look at the graphics- these provide clues about the topic
 Look for titles, captions, subject-related words, and graphics to identify the topic
